About our presenter: Elizabeth A. Abbs is a Doctor of Audiology. She completed her undergraduate career at the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ign, where she obtained a bachelor’s degree in speech and hearing science with a concentration in audiology. She went on to complete her clinical doctorate degree in audiology from Northwestern University. Clinically, she provides the following services: adult diagnostic testing for hearing loss, hearing aid evaluations, fittings and services, tinnitus management and counseling, and testing/treatment for Benign Paroxysmal Positional Vertigo.
